Jenna McCammon Bedsole Graduated from the University of Alabama in 1993 with Bachelors of Arts in English and a minor in History. In 1997, Jenna graduated from the University of Alabama School of Law. She is a partner with Lloyd, Gray & Whitehead, P.C. and practices in the areas of education and employment law. In 2005, she served as the President of the Young Lawyer’s Section of the Birmingham Bar. She was selected as a member of the inaugural class of the Alabama State Bar Leadership Forum. Jenna also currently serves on the Board of Directors for the Birmingham Bar Foundation, the charitable arm of the Birmingham Bar Association. In 2007, Jenna was elected onto the advisory board of the Blakburn Institute. She is married to Chess Bedsole and they have one child, Helen Bedsole.

Brannon Buck Brannon is a founding partner of Badham & Buck, LLC. Before starting his own firm, Brannon was a partner at Maynard, Cooper & Gale, P.C. Brannon has a civil litigation and trial practice. He is a past president of the Young Lawyers Section of the Alabama State Bar Association and currently chairs committees of both the Alabama Bar and the Birmingham Bar Associations. Brannon also serves on the Boards of the Alabama Apppleseed, Center for Law and Justice, the Alabama Civil Justice Foundation, and Canterbury United Methodist Church.

Lee Garrison Graduated from the University of Alabama in 1997 with a BS degree in Commerce and Business Administration. In August of 1997, while still an undergraduate at UA, Lee ran a successful bid for City Council, District 4. Councilman Garrison also works as a salesman for Duckworth-Morris Insurance. In August of 2001, Councilman Garrison ran unopposed for the District 4 council seat. Councilman Garrison is chair of the Finance Committee, Vice Chair of the Intergovernmental Relations Committee, and a member of Public Project Committee. On, January 24, 2004, Lee was voted into the Blackburn Institute's Advisory Board. Lee is married to Jessica who was University of Alabama SGA President (1996) and is a practicing attorney at the firm Phelps, Jenkins, Gibson, and Fowler in Tuscaloosa. Lee also serves the Boys and Girls Club of West Alabama, Chairman of the Board; Tuscaloosa Riverfront Development Steering Committee, Vice-Chairman; Chairman of the Community & Economic Development Committee; and the Downtown Urban Renewal Committee.

Eric Pruitt Eric is a member of the Institute's Advisory Board and previously served as Chairman of the Fellow Involvement Network in 2007. In addition to practicing law as a shareholder in the Birmingham, AL office of Baker, Donelson, Bearman, Caldwell, & Berkowitz, P.C., Eric serves as the advisor to the firm's business associates in Atlanta, Chattanooga, and Birmingham, in addition to working with the firm's Professional Development Department to train and mentor young lawyers. Eric received his undergraduate and law degrees from the University of Alabama. Eric and his wife Aimee, who both received their L.L.M. degrees from New York University, currently reside in Vestavia Hills, AL.
